In today's world, over 7,000 different languages are spoken. English is one of the most recognized languages in the word and is the language of choice for many people across the globe. For this reason it plays an integral role in communication between different societies and organizations. It is important that global workers can effectively use this style of English in order to be successful in the world business markets.
Global English, also known as international English, is the movement towards using an international standard for this common language. It is also the concept of using the English language as a means of communication across the world and in various dialects. In today's society of constant communication among people around the world, it is important that the English language is not tied to one local dialect such as the United States, the UK or Australia, but rather represents a broad usage of language so that it can be understood in all countries. When using global English, it is important to write and speak clearly so it can be understood around the world. This involves streamlining the use of syntax and avoiding culture specific idioms.
There are a variety of techniques that can be implemented to successfully use global English. Avoid long and wordy sentences and paragraphs. Refrain from using false subjects, such as sentences that start with "It is" or "This has" which can be confusing. Instead, start the sentence with a specific descriptive subject. Do not use mini word clusters because it may confuse anyone who is just learning the English languages. Mini words are short, common words with one to three letters. Avoid using idioms, such as "the tip of the iceberg" and "right around the corner." Instead, say exactly what you mean. Also, because many languages do not use pronouns such as "it" or "they", try to avoid them. Refrain from using phrasal verbs, such as "keep up" or "get into" because they are difficult to understand in any languages. Finally, since most languages have different formats for writing dates, it is best to write out the month, date and year completely.
As a business around the world build a global clientele, it is important that they can read and write global English. By understanding the concepts of this language and using proper techniques, a business can successfully grow in the global business economy.
